Understanding Loyalty Program Marketing
Loyalty programs are designed to reward customers for their repeat business, encouraging them to choose your brand over competitors. These programs can take various forms, including point systems, tiered rewards, and exclusive offers. The ultimate goal is to create a strong emotional connection that keeps customers coming back.
Benefits of Implementing a Loyalty Program
A well-executed loyalty program can provide several benefits for businesses in Gauteng:
- Increased Customer Retention: Loyalty programs are proven to enhance customer satisfaction and foster long-term relationships.
- Better Insight on Customer Preferences: By analyzing the behavior of loyalty program members, you gain valuable data that can inform your marketing strategies.
- Higher Average Transaction Values: Loyal customers are more likely to spend more per visit, increasing overall sales.
Key Strategies for Loyalty Program Marketing
Here are some effective strategies to consider when developing your loyalty program:
- Create a User-Friendly Experience: Ensure that signing up for the loyalty program is simple and quick. Provide clear instructions on how customers can earn and redeem rewards.
- Offer Personalized Rewards: Tailor rewards based on individual customer preferences and purchasing behaviors to make them feel special.
- Leverage Mobile Technology: Use mobile apps to provide customers with easy access to their loyalty program details, rewards, and promotions.
Effective Communication is Key
Regularly communicate with your loyalty program members to keep them engaged. Use email newsletters, social media, and personalized offers to remind them of their benefits and encourage participation.
Case Study: Loyalty Program Success in Gauteng
Several businesses in Gauteng have successfully implemented loyalty programs. For example, a local coffee shop saw a 30% increase in repeat customers within six months of launching their rewards program. By offering a free drink after the purchase of ten, they motivated customers to return, and the program also enhanced their customer database for future promotions.
